Historical note: Dr. Courts Redford was President of Southwest Baptist College from 1930 to 1943, leading the then Junior College through one of its most uncertain periods. After serving 21 years with the Home Mission Board of the Southern Baptist Convention, the last ten years as the chief executive officer, he retired in 1964. After moving back to Bolivar in 1966, Dr. Redford again served Southwest as Interim President for 9 months in 1967. The College's Division of Christianity and Philosophy was officially renamed in his honor in the Fall of 1973. —See Dr. Courts Redford, his life and labors, by Geoffrey S. Swadley, c. 1974.

A picture of Dr. Redford hangs in the main reception area of the newly remodled James Mellers Center which houses the classrooms and faculty offices of the Courts Redford College of Theology and Ministry, one of SBU's six colleges.
